No cash, but bag of groceries for 2 holdup men

Ding Cervantes - The Philippine Star

SAN FERNANDO, Pampanga, Philippines – They mapped out a daring daytime holdup for a bagful of cash, but carted off a bagful of coffee and canned goods instead.

City police chief Ric David said his men are now hunting down the two motorcycle-riding men who held up Celestino Simbulan, 40, and relative Zeny Mallari, 54, as they were about to board their Nissan sports utility vehicle after withdrawing cash from a bank in Barangay Dolores here last Monday.

The victims though first dropped by the supermarket before they went to the bank.

When the two men announced a holdup, Simbulan put up a fight and was hit on the head. Mallari grabbed the bagful of grocery items and gave it to one of the two men, who immediately fled thinking they got the cash.
